Transaction 5184c072874057b5344364bffa23d365c4a81e41d4f9baca66c54797ae66463d
1 Input
1 Output
-
5184c072874057b5344364bffa23d365c4a81e41d4f9baca66c54797ae66463d:0
- value
- 12389
- script pubkey
- OP_0 OP_PUSHBYTES_20 058319576a7edefb6838bfad3e949b3d5c0ae44f
- address
- bc1qqkp3j4m20m00k6pch7kna9ym84wq4ez06m7282